1: Chest Builder:


Now everybody craves for a wide chest. It enhances ones personality and puts a greater impact on it. So an easy technique for a wider chest is lay on a flat bench as if you were doing a bench-press. With a smaller bar, usually the ones with curved hand areas, place your hands toward the center for better results, with index fingers about 5 inches apart. Then you have to place the bar between the nipple region, and move it only about one inch above your face, then behind your head, and as close to the ground as possible. Then pull it back to its starting position, keeping it about an inch above your face/chest at all times. This is a very useful technique, and not too difficult.

3: Dumbbell Shoulder Press:


Dumbbell shoulders press dramatically increases the tension on the delts throughout the entire exercise. When doing dumbbell shoulders presses, tilt the dumbbells in towards your head throughout the movement as though you’re pouring water on your head with a pitcher.


4: Bigger & More Toned Pectoral Muscles:


Getting well-toned pectoral muscles is necessary for a well-toned body. It can be achieved by incline Press, 3-4 sets of 6-8 reps, Bench Press-2, Close-grip bench press-3-4 sets of 6-8 reps with hands 4 inches apart, dips-3-4 sets of 12-15-20 reps.


5: DIET PLAN:


Doing rigorous exercise cannot help alone for bodybuilding. Maintaining a proper diet plan is very essential for aiding the exercise. One should increase the amount of fat in diet because increasing the amount of fat in your diet increases the amount of anabolic (muscle building) hormones in your body. Also increase the amount of protein in your diet. In order for muscle tissue to repair itself after your weight-training sessions it needs an adequate amount of protein diet like chicken, Pork, Seafood – tuna, prawns, salmon etc, steak, nuts, eggs, Protein Powder Shakes etc.
